Spicy Cucumber Salad
This asian-inspired Spicy Cucumber Salad features simple ingredients and is ready in less than 15 minutes!

π Preparation Steps
1
Slice the cucumbers into thin slices, and place them in a large bowl. Sprinkle with 1 Β½ teaspoons of salt and stir to combine. Set aside for β±οΈ 5-10 minutes.
2
Drain off the excess water, and rinse the cucumber slices under cold running water.
3
Spread the cucumbers out on several layers of paper towels (or a clean kitchen towel) and cover the tops with more paper towel (or another kitchen towel). Press gently to absorb excess water.
4
Place the cucumbers in a large bowl.
5
Prepare the dressing. Add the soy sauce, toasted sesame oil, honey, chili garlic sauce, garlic, and pepper to a small glass bowl or measuring cup. Whisk until the honey dissolves and itβs well combined.
soy sauce (gluten-free or tamari if needed)3 tablespoonstoasted sesame oil1 tablespoonhoney1 tablespoonPepper (to taste (just a few cracks))
6
Pour the dressing over the cucumbers, and stir gently to coat them evenly.
7
Sprinkle with sesame seeds (if using), and stir gently once again.
8
Serve immediately for the best results.
